Abstract
Manufacturing industry is experiencing several fundamental changes. From industrial sector perspectives, in many industries such as home electronics appliance, computer,telecommunication, semiconductor, and even bio-technology, the traditional vertical-integrated company based business model has been dramatically replaced bycollaborations between many fragmented but complementary and specialized value stars and value constellations. From geographic perspectives, more and more activitiesof value creation in manufacturing are reallocated in developing nations, especially in the Far East region where is emerging as a new factory of the world. From businessdynamics perspectives, it is interesting to observe that, when some companies are seeking subcontracting or even hollowing-out by positioning themselves to engage withvariously final customers directly, at the same time, others are accumulating up the outsourced tasks and sharply focusing on few core capable skills to provide operationalservice in a very professional way. It is more exciting to understand not only the interactions between original equipment manufacturers (OEMs) and electronicsmanufacturing service (EMS) providers but also their evolutionary adaptations and even place exchanges. In general, globalization between nations and collaborationbetween firms are deeply challenging the existing business models and classical concepts such as manufacturing, service, supply chain, and even firm or enterprise.This special issue of the International Journal of Business aims to address the critical issues involved in global manufacturing network by using electronics industryas a reference model. Conceptual models and quantitative analysis methodologies are proposed to deal with wide range of challenges of global manufacturing and supplychain via validation with empirical research and observation in real setting. Its complexity includes severaldimensions such as the system of manufacturing and supply chain itself with expansions of the boundaries and dynamics from shop floor, to factory/plant and to factory network in big multinational corporations;internationalization engaging different nations and dispersions of resources;collaborations with different alliances with different modes of co-operations;and synthesis of them all together in order to achieve integrated power for growth and competitiveness. All of these ask new management visions, tools, and processes. Secondly, reading between the papers in this special issue, an evolutionary pathmight be able to be identified. Different countries or regions are studying and concerning different issues from production in China, to supply chain synchronizationin Singapore, evaluation and appraisal of R&D projects as well as government technology strategy in Taiwan, and up-grading and focusing on innovation power inSouth Korea. They interestingly reflect different stages of development and maturity in industrialization. It might be more interesting to observe whether knowledge flow and capability evolutions happen in the transformation between the stages. Finally, this special issue has a clear focus on operational issues in contrastingwith the manufacturing paradigm shifts in the Far East manufacturing industry. Is this Asian academic limitation? On one hand, it is obvious that the Asian industry iscreating a new business which fundamentally transforms manufacturing from vertical integrated firm model into virtual collaborative inter-firm network model, but on theother hand, the Asian academia have not realized its significant impacts. Indeed, new technologies and business models have had profound effect on practices ofmanagement, yet the managerial research falls far behind the needs in real settings. Most of the Asian researchers still follow the linear path developed by the westernscholars based on their industry demands and successes. The academics in developing nations should have more confidences to study national or local issues and generalize own business models, which will contribute more fundamentally to both industrial and academic worlds.
